Two of my favorite species showed up at my home in Birchwood (Hamilton County)
today to eat homemade, slightly modified Stokes recipe peanut butter suet. A
first-of-the-year adult Red-headed Woodpecker came to a sassafras suet log. The
log is about two feet long with 10 one-inch diameter holes of varying depths
drilled on opposite sides. Later a Brown-headed Nuthatch came to a suet cage
and then grabbed a sunflower seed and left.
